The European Audiovisual Observatory publishes a new analysis of the impact of fiscal incentive schemes – tax shelters, tax rebates and tax credits -  which aim at stimulating investment in the production of film and audiovisual works. The analysis identifies, describes and categorises the schemes in place across Europe and evaluates their impact in attracting foreign investment, both from within Europe and from other countries too. It then compares the various schemes according to their advantages/disadvantages and examines how they work alongside other economic and political measures. The report concludes by evaluating the impact of these systems in the international context.

This analysis was carried out by one of Europe’s leading screen sector development consultancies, Olsberg•SPI, providing specialist, high level advice for over 20 years to public and private sector clients in the creative industries, focusing on film, television and digital media.
